| Benchmark. Benchmark é um módulo Perl com horários de dados de referência de código Perl. |
Baixe Agora |
Benchmark. Classificação e resumo
- Licença:
- Perl Artistic License
- Nome do editor:
- Jarkko Hietaniemi and Tim Bunce
- Site do editor:
- http://search.cpan.org/~nwclark/
Benchmark. Tag
Benchmark. Descrição
Benchmark é um módulo Perl com horários de ração de referência do código Perl. O Benchmark é um módulo Perl com os tempos de execução de referência de Código Perl.Synopsis Use Benchmark QW (: ALL); timethis ($ contagem, "código"); # Use o Código Perl em strings ... Timethese ($ contagem, {'Name1' => '... code1 ...', 'Name2' => '... Código2 ...',}); # ... ou use referências sub-rotinas. timethese ($ contagem, {'name1' => sub {... code1 ...}, 'name2' => sub {... code2 ...},}); # cmpteseses podem ser usados em ambas as maneiras também cmptesese ($ contagem, {'nome1' => '... code1 ...', 'Nome2' => '... Código2 ...',}); cmptese ($ contagem, {'name1' => sub {... code1 ...}, 'name2' => sub {... code2 ...},}); # ... ou em duas etapas $ Results = Timethese ($ contagem, {'name1' => sub {... clede1 ...}, 'name2' => sub {... code2 ...} , 'Nenhum' ); cmptese ($ Resultados); $ t = TIMEIT ($ COUNT, '... OUTRO CÓDIGO ...' '($ count loops de outro código levou: ", TimestR ($ T)," N "; $ t = countit ($ horário, '... outro código ...') $ contagem = $ t-> iters; Imprimir "$ contagem loops de outro código levou:", TimestR ($ t), "N"; # Ativar o tempo de wallclock Hires Se possível Benchmark ': hireswallclock'; o módulo de benchmark encapsula uma série de rotinas para ajudá-lo a descobrir quanto tempo demora para executar algum código.Timethis - Execute um pedaço de código vários timestimethese - execute vários pedaços de Código Vários TimescmpThese - Imprimir resultados de Timethese como uma comparação CHARATTTIMEIT - Execute um pedaço de código e veja por quanto tempo GoScountit - veja quantas vezes um pedaço de código é executado em um determinado requisitos de tempo: · Perl.
Benchmark. Software Relacionado